What's shifting

From clunky held-away interfaces to native trading rails

Historically, advising on a client's 401(k) meant navigating clunky, disconnected interfaces and dealing with severe compliance hurdles regarding custody and discretionary trading. API-driven platforms (like Pontera) and smart-contract networks are disrupting this by securely bridging the advisor's core rebalancing software directly into the client's held-away retirement account. This allows the advisor to seamlessly trade and bill on 401(k) assets as if they were natively custodied, dramatically expanding their addressable AUM.
